# # Some simple rules: |
|
# |
|
# * All lines starting with `# ` are considered markdown, everything else is considered code |
|
# * The file is parsed in "chunks" of code and markdown. A new chunk is created when the |
|
# lines switch context from markdown to code and vice versa. |
|
# * Lines starting with `#-` can be used to start a new chunk. |
|
# * Lines starting/ending with `#md` are filtered out unless creating a markdown file |
|
# * Lines starting/ending with `#nb` are filtered out unless creating a notebook |
|
# * Lines starting/ending with, `#jl` are filtered out unless creating a script file |
|
# * Lines starting/ending with, `#src` are filtered out unconditionally |
|
# * #md, #nb, and #jl can be negated as #!md, #!nb, and #!jl |
|
# * Whitespace within a chunk is preserved |
|
# * Empty chunks are removed, leading and trailing empty lines in a chunk are also removed |

""" |
|
DEFAULT_CONFIGURATION |
|
|
|
Default configuration for [`Literate.markdown`](@ref), [`Literate.notebook`](@ref) and |
|
[`Literate.script`](@ref) which is used for everything not specified by the user. |
|
Configuration can be passed as individual keyword arguments or as a dictionary passed |
|
with the `config` keyword argument. |
|
See the manual section about [Configuration](@ref) for more information. |
|
|
|
Available options: |
|
|
|
- `name` (default: `filename(inputfile)`): Name of the output file (excluding the file |
|
extension). |
|
- `preprocess` (default: `identity`): Custom preprocessing function mapping a `String` to |
|
a `String`. See [Custom pre- and post-processing](@ref Custom-pre-and-post-processing). |
|
- `postprocess` (default: `identity`): Custom preprocessing function mapping a `String` to |
|
a `String`. See [Custom pre- and post-processing](@ref Custom-pre-and-post-processing). |
|
- `credit` (default: `true`): Boolean for controlling the addition of |
|
`This file was generated with Literate.jl ...` to the bottom of the page. If you find |
|
Literate.jl useful then feel free to keep this. |
|
- `keep_comments` (default: `false`): When `true`, keeps markdown lines as comments in the |
|
output script. Only applicable for `Literate.script`. |
|
- `execute` (default: `true` for notebook, `false` for markdown): Whether to execute and |
|
capture the output. Only applicable for `Literate.notebook` and `Literate.markdown`. |
|
- `continue_on_error` (default: `false`): Whether to continue code execution of remaining |
|
blocks after encountering an error. By default execution errors are re-thrown. If |
|
`continue_on_error = true` the error will be used as the output of the block instead and |
|
execution will continue. This option is only applicable when `execute = true`. |
|
- `codefence` (default: `````"````@example \$(name)" => "````"````` for `DocumenterFlavor()` |
|
and `````"````julia" => "````"````` otherwise): Pair containing opening and closing |
|
code fence for wrapping code blocks. |
|
- `flavor` (default: `Literate.DocumenterFlavor()`) Output flavor for markdown, see |
|
[Markdown flavors](@ref). Only applicable for `Literate.markdown`. |
|
- `devurl` (default: `"dev"`): URL for "in-development" docs, see [Documenter docs] |
|
(https://juliadocs.github.io/Documenter.jl/). Unused if `repo_root_url`/ |
|
`nbviewer_root_url`/`binder_root_url` are set. |
|
- `softscope` (default: `true` for Jupyter notebooks, `false` otherwise): enable/disable |
|
"soft" scoping rules when executing, see e.g. https://github.com/JuliaLang/SoftGlobalScope.jl. |
|
- `repo_root_url`: URL to the root of the repository. Determined automatically on Travis CI, |
|
GitHub Actions and GitLab CI. Used for `@__REPO_ROOT_URL__`. |
|
- `nbviewer_root_url`: URL to the root of the repository as seen on nbviewer. Determined |
|
automatically on Travis CI, GitHub Actions and GitLab CI. |
|
Used for `@__NBVIEWER_ROOT_URL__`. |
|
- `binder_root_url`: URL to the root of the repository as seen on mybinder. Determined |
|
automatically on Travis CI, GitHub Actions and GitLab CI. |
|
Used for `@__BINDER_ROOT_URL__`. |
|
- `image_formats`: A vector of `(mime, ext)` tuples, with the default |
|
`$(_DEFAULT_IMAGE_FORMATS)`. Results which are `showable` with a MIME type are saved with |
|
the first match, with the corresponding extension. |
|
""" |
